Crown Crafts Inc reported earnings per share (EPS) of $0.14 for the first quarter of fiscal 2026, with no analyst estimate available for comparison. Revenue figures were not disclosed by the company. The stock moved up by $0.55 in the session following the release, reflecting cautious investor sentiment. Given the lack of consensus estimates and top-line data, this report focuses on the limited available metrics and broader operational context.

Crown Crafts Inc, a provider of infant, toddler, and juvenile products, delivered first-quarter EPS of $0.14. While the absence of a revenue figure leaves the top-line picture incomplete, the EPS result suggests that the company maintained profitability during a typically seasonal period. The company’s product categories—including bedding, bibs, and blankets—may have benefited from stable consumer demand for essential juvenile goods. Operating margins were not explicitly reported, but the EPS implies cost control measures are in place. Historically, Crown Crafts focuses on licensed and branded merchandise, which provides some pricing power. However, without segment breakdowns, it is difficult to assess the performance of specific divisions such as the direct-to-consumer or wholesale channels. The stock’s slight uptick of $0.55 indicates that investors may have viewed the EPS result as neutral to slightly positive, though the lack of revenue disclosure limits the depth of analysis.

Management did not provide forward guidance in the initial release, but the company may offer updated expectations during its earnings call. Crown Crafts has previously emphasized brand partnerships and e-commerce growth as strategic priorities. These initiatives could support revenue stabilization in a competitive juvenile products market. Risk factors include potential input cost inflation, supply chain disruptions, and shifting consumer spending patterns. Additionally, the company’s reliance on licensing agreements exposes it to changes in licensee strategies. While Q1 results demonstrated maintained profitability, the absence of revenue data raises questions about sales momentum. Investors may watch for any commentary on back-to-school or holiday season demand, though cautious language is warranted given the limited disclosures.

The stock’s $0.55 move higher suggests a restrained but not negative reaction to the Q1 EPS figure. Without analyst estimates or revenue comparisons, the market may be weighing the EPS in isolation. Some investors might interpret the lack of negative surprises as a sign of operational stability. However, the incomplete data set could also prompt skepticism. Key items to monitor in the coming months include whether Crown Crafts provides revenue breakdowns in its 10-Q filing and any updates to its licensing portfolio. The juvenile products sector faces headwinds from demographic trends and retail consolidation, but the company’s niche focus may offer resilience. The cautious outlook remains: the Q1 report offers limited actionable information, and further clarity is needed to assess the company’s financial health fully.
